Finalland’s Mahesh Cabi took the world records in the International T20 balls


The Mahesh Cubi of Finland has given history in T20 International cricket. Mahesh Cabs have recorded a record to take the fastest 5 wickets in T20 International cricket. Mahsh Cabi made history by taking 5 wickets in just 8 balls during the Twenty20 match against Estonia. By doing so, Copper has broken the record of Rashid Khan and Juneed Aziz. Rashid Khan removal of taking 5 wickets in 11 balls in 2017. At the same time, the Juneed Aziz, the Bahrain had recorded 5 wickets in 10 balls, but now the record of 5 wickets in T20 International cricket has been recorded. Earlier, the record was the name of the Bahrain Junaid Aziz, which took 5 balls in only 10 balls against Germany in 2022. Cabbar has been able to achieve this achievement in the third spell match played between Finland and Estonia.

The fastest five wickets in the men’s T20 international cricket

  • 8 balls: Mahesh copper (Finland) vs Eastonia, 2025 *

  • 10 balls – Juneed Aziz (Bahrain) vs Germany, 2022

  • 11 balls: Rashid Khan (Afghanistan) vs. Ireland, 2017

  • 11 balls – malavis beg (Malawi) vs. Cameroon, 2024

Speaking of the match, Estonia batted in the third-match match between Finland vs Estonia, and the Finland’s team scored a match 142 in 18.1 overs. Mahesh Cabi bowled a magnificent in the match and took 5 wickets for 19 runs in 2 overs and was given the player of the match.
